WebOct 11, 2024 · The general formula used when determining how to find moment of inertia of a rectangle is: I x x = B D 3 12, I y y = B 3 D 12 Where the xx and yy refer to the particular axis, or direction, being considered. It is a common structural engineering convention that B refers to the width of the rectangle, parallel to a conventionally horizontal x-axis.
